Bachelorette alum JoJo Fletcher has revealed she faced an agonizing decision to pose in a bikini just months after welcoming her first child via an emergency C-section in an exclusive interview with The Daily Mail. The reality star, 35, and her husband, Jordan Rodgers, 37, have been in newborn 'bliss' since welcoming their first child together, a daughter named Romy Blair Rodgers, in December 2025.
But just months after welcoming Romy, Fletcher had to decide if she was ready for the world to see her in a bathing suit. The star will be releasing her latest swimsuit collection with Cupshe on May 15 and was set to do a bikini photo shoot to promote the range shortly after giving birth.
It's a daunting prospect that would rattle any new mother, but one that Fletcher decided to embrace as an opportunity to begin her 'new chapter' as a mom. 'We shot the collection, the photo shoot for the collection was a couple months postpartum, which was a whole thing. I was like, "Oh my gosh. Am I ready for this?"' she told The Daily Mail. 'But I was like, "You know what? I'm just going to own this new chapter of my life. And like, I'm a mom now, and I love it. I love what my body was able to do and to give us."'
The decision to wear a bathing suit so soon after childbirth isn't the only issue many mothers can relate to Fletcher with. 'The newborn trenches can be rough,' she said. 'I think every mom can say that, but there's such a true statement to the newborn bliss and this new life that you're kind of starting and embarking on.'

Cupshe Collaboration and Future Plans
Fletcher's Cupshe line, Set Sail, will be released via two different installments, with the first chapter dropping on May 15 and a second range following on May 29. It features 60 Fletcher-approved styles that are priced around $30 to $50. When asked about a potential mommy and me collection, she said, 'When we were designing this collection, I was thinking about my daughter, Romy. And the team was so sweet, they made Romy some just little sample swimsuit. I have yet to put her in 'em yet. I'm like, "When am I gonna do that?" But I feel like that'd be super, super cute. When I do my try-ons for this collection, I'm gonna put her in it, and it'll be super, super cute to share. But I would love to do that.'
